Ballet of the elephants

Tells the story of how circus owner John Ringling North, choreographer George Balanchine, and composer Igor Stravinsky teamed up to create the "Circus Polka," a ballet for fifty elephants and fifty dancers, and describes the opening night performance in 1942.
